It is estimated that per second each square meter of earth receives about 1400 J of heat energy from the Sun. This is called Solar constant. The value of solar constant in some system is _________ cal/cm2-min. (1 cal = 4.2 J) .

Moderate
Solution

1400J/m2sec=ncal/cm2min1400Jm2sec=n4.2J×10000m260secn=2
